Ingredients

for
1
Ingredients
400 grams Puff pastry dough
250 grams Quark
1 tsp freshly chopped ginger
1 egg
2 Tbsps sugar
3 Banana
2 Tbsps lemon juice
1 Vanilla bean
80 grams Lemon marmalade

Preparation steps

1.

Preheat a convection oven to 200°C (approximately 400°F).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

2.

Roll the puff pastry to a rectangle about 20 x 30 cm (approximately 8 x 12 inches). Transfer to the lined baking sheet. Mix the quark with ginger, egg, and sugar until blended, Spread in an even layer over the dough, except for a border about 1 cm (approximately 1/2 inch) around the edges of the dough.

Split the vanilla bean, scrape out the seeds, and add to the lemon marmalade in a small pot. Warm the marmalade over low heat until melted. Let the marmalade cool slightly.
